Transaction 706305b2410c724b0fc315cc8f8a50c3ac36869430f169e4938c987c5c7a0acb
1 Input
2 Outputs
- 706305b2410c724b0fc315cc8f8a50c3ac36869430f169e4938c987c5c7a0acb:0
- 706305b2410c724b0fc315cc8f8a50c3ac36869430f169e4938c987c5c7a0acb:1
value 314424
address 16fhJuAV1NM4wGVLuG5TuYoSWcQkPjyYY7
value 28644884
address 1KvZ8vhhvkdgHBTfoRUTbihEtZKXTTyXm8